Kesha Urges LGBTQ+ Activism Amid Rising Challenges and Chaos

Kesha, the celebrated pop artist, recently utilized her platform to rally the LGBTQ+ community during a poignant moment at the Lesbian, Gay, Bisexual & Transgender Community Center’s annual fundraising dinner in New York City. Honored with the prestigious visionary award, Kesha’s speech resonated with urgency as she called for a radical embrace of love and authenticity in the face of escalating “hate” and “chaos.” Speaking candidly about her personal journey and recent struggles, Kesha emphasized the importance of community and resilience in challenging times. As she prepares to release her new album, “(PERIOD),” on July 4, Kesha highlighted her empowerment as the CEO of her own label, Kesha Records, marking a significant milestone in her professional and personal life.
Kesha’s remarks were particularly poignant, reflecting a broader societal context where LGBTQ+ rights are increasingly under threat. The artist, who has navigated a tumultuous career, including a high-profile legal battle with producer Dr. Luke, acknowledged that adversity has shaped her strength and empathy. This aligns with recent findings from the Human Rights Campaign, which reported a growing number of anti-LGBTQ+ legislative measures across the United States, underscoring the urgency of Kesha’s message.
During her address, Kesha expressed a heartfelt connection to the audience, indicating that overcoming personal and societal challenges is a shared experience among members of the LGBTQ+ community. “We are just people fighting for our lives to just be ourselves, to just be safe, to just be seen, to just be free,” she stated, reinforcing the idea that the fight for equality is a collective one. Her call to action—”the most political thing we can do is to love ourselves and love one another”—serves as a reminder of the power of community solidarity in times of adversity.
The event also recognized other notable figures, such as Susie Scher from Goldman Sachs and Ruth Jacks from Wells Fargo, signaling a broader movement within corporate and philanthropic sectors to advocate for LGBTQ+ rights. Kesha’s heartfelt expressions of gratitude towards the community highlighted the importance of safe spaces and mutual support, especially amidst a political landscape that many perceive as increasingly hostile to basic human rights.
